John Miskella (born 7 March 1978) is an Irish former sportsperson. He played Gaelic football with the Ballincollig club and with the Cork senior inter-county team.

Playing career

Miskella made his debut for the Cork team in 1999 against Waterford.[1]

Miskella received an All-Star in 2009 for his performances on Cork's run to the All-Ireland final.[citation needed]

Miskella announced his retirement in 2011 due to a groin injury.[2]
